Transaction 105faa3923fe2cc2c15d9a3ca59047a8e26358c09d9993c6231a3bd11b4d515d
1 Input
1 Output
-
105faa3923fe2cc2c15d9a3ca59047a8e26358c09d9993c6231a3bd11b4d515d:0
- value
- 34900
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ac86ad3a6e75a150f4ccc7f6bfe245f0d359bb8b
- address
- bc1q4jr26wnwwks4paxvclmtlcj97rf4nwutykx8rw